Paul Brown"Freddie" Thomas The First Rider To Win The New Jersey Hunt Cup Twice
About the Item
Quickens The Pace At The 25th Fence And Goes On To Win 1931
Inscribed LL: Merry Christmas and a lot of winning rides in 1932 To Roberta and "Freddie" from the Paul Browns
Mixed Media w/ Gouache highlights
Art Sz: 10 1/2"H x 17"W
Frame Sz: 15 5/8"H x 22 1/4"W
